I'm running into restrictions with File and Print Sharing
with my DMZ system. Here's the layout
DMZ: Windows XP SP1 Desktop
LAN:
1) Windows XP SP1 Laptop
2) Windows 2000 Desktop
Now, of course, my DMZ pc has no problem connecting to
shares and/or pinging the LAN pcs, but nothing on my LAN
can ping or share items off of my DMZ pc. I don't see
and settings in the web configuration that allow me to
specify allowing all LAN->DMZ traffic. Is this feature
just NOT supported? Will the LAN never see the DMZ? Or
are there some settings hidden somewhere that I'm not
seeing?
